Abstract

The concatenated Greenberger---Horne---Zeilinger state is a new type of logic-qubit entanglement, which attracts a lot of attentions recently. In this paper, we discuss the entanglement concentration for such logic-qubit entanglement. We present two groups of entanglement concentration protocols (ECPs) for logic-qubit entanglement. In the first group, the parties do not know the initial coefficients of the partially logic-qubit entanglement. In the second group, the parties know the initial coefficients of the partially logic-qubit entanglement. In our ECPs, the unsuccessful cases can be reused to increase the total success probability in the next step. These ECPs may be useful in future long-distant quantum communication.
